Transaction 0123691aac7a66e3028d035dfaa22de77f361fc17e063006baf50ecba6a924b5
1 Input
1 Output
-
0123691aac7a66e3028d035dfaa22de77f361fc17e063006baf50ecba6a924b5:0
- value
- 8740
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 23bbc54e460242e3e83d205eb65b901ec81d75451744a79b1de8edf6edfba60b
- address
- bc1pywau2njxqfpw86payp0tvkusrmyp6a29zaz20xcaarkldm0m5c9sygk4va